6.2.5 Flight Battery Alerts The controller monitors the Solo battery during flight and provides alerts when the battery reaches critical levels. At 25% and 10% power remaining, the controller will provide a land-soon alert recommending that you end your flight to prevent an automatic landing. Figure 6.2.5.1: Controller - Low Battery Alerts If the battery reaches 5%, Solo will Return Home to prevent a crash. After landing, turn off Solo immediately; if the battery level reaches 0% at any time, irreversible damage will occur and the battery should be recycled.
